Afficher les informations de votre serveur avec PhpSysInfo

PhpSysInfo est une interface PHP qui permet d’afficher un résumé d’informations sur le système et le matériel du serveur sur lequel est hébergé le script.

It will displays things like Uptime, CPU, Memory, SCSI, IDE, PCI, Ethernet, Floppy, and Video Information.

Les informations sont relativement complètes, et permettent d’avoir une vue rapide de votre système : j’ai l’habitude de l’utiliser des serveurs qui ne font pas partie de « fermes« .

PhpSysInfo : informations sur votre serveur grâce à un script PHP

(suite…)

Comment migrer sur MySQL5 chez OVH

Étant client depuis fort longtemps chez OVH, je me trainais encore une base MySQL4, laquelle ne me dérangeait pas le moins du monde puisque je n’avais pas besoin des fonctionnalités supplémentaires.

Note : je rappelle que MySQL est un Système de Gestion de Base de Données, utilisé dans ce cas pour stocker les données de ce blog, telles que les articles, les commentaires, etc. Ces données sont exploitées par un serveur d’application Apache et un langage de script PHP.

En tentant de mettre à jour mon blog vers WordPress 2.9, mon installation de WordPress m’a prévenu que c’était impossible si je ne passais pas sur une version supérieure de MySQL.

The update cannot be installed because WordPress 2.9.2 requires MySQL version 4.1.2 or higher. You are running version 4.0.25.

Bref, je n’avais pas trop le choix !

(suite…)

Gérer le contenu de votre disque avec TreeSize

Mais où sont passés tous les Gigaoctets qui manquent sur mon disque dur ? Facile de retrouver dans quel répertoire se trouve l‘espace disque consommé avec TreeSize Free.

Après quelques secondes d’analyse sur une partition complète, chaque répertoire indiquera l’espace qu’il consomme sous forme graphique. Dans mon cas par exemple, il se trouve que c’est Google Gears qui télécharge mon compte Gmail en entier pour le stocker en local. Spotify a également l’air de rapatrier les morceaux en local, même si je n’ai pas souscrit à l’offre Premium…

Taille de vos répertoires avec TreeSize Free

Taille de vos répertoires avec TreeSize Free

A noter : il existe également une version de TreeSize pour votre mobile (à condition que celui-ci tourne sur Windows mobile).

Comment trouver des répertoires vides sur Linux

Quand on est un peu maniaque du système de fichier (comme moi), les répertoires vides sont comme autant d’épines dans son pied. :)

Plus concrètement, la recherche de répertoires vides peut avoir plusieurs buts :

  • à des fins de maintenance,
  • à des fins de sauvegarde,
  • à des fins de tests : tester si un répertoire est vide avant de faire une action, ou pour vérifier si une action s’est bien déroulée,
  • etc.

Sur Linux, plusieurs commandes sympa permettent de retrouver facilement les répertoires vides, et de faire une action sur le résultat (si besoin).

Pour recenser les répertoires vides :

find /chemin -type d -empty

Pour faire une liste avec des infos plus pointues sur les répertoires vides :

find /chemin -type d -empty -exec ls -ld {} \;

Pour rechercher tous les répertoires vides et les supprimer :

find /chemin -type d -empty -exec rmdir {} \;

Ou, un poil plus bourrin :

find /chemin -type d -empty -exec rm -rf {} \;

Bon amusement ! ;)

Restreindre l’accès à un répertoire par mot de passe avec un fichier htaccess sur Apache

Parmi la multitude de fonctionnalités qu’offrent les fichiers .htaccess, il est possible de restreindre l’accès à un répertoire par un mot de passe.

Cette technique est relativement connue et bien documentée, mais faire un article me permettra de retrouver rapidement la syntaxe exacte la prochaine fois que je chercherai. ;)

Protection d'un répertoire avec un mot de passe sur Apache

Protection d'un répertoire avec un mot de passe sur Apache

Ce n’est pas mon premier article sur .htaccess, j’avais notamment expliqué comment empêcher le listage des répertoires, comment faire une page de maintenance avec un fichier .htaccess, restreindre l’accès à un répertoire par adresse IP, etc.

(suite…)

Ma semaine à Barcelone : conférence Cisco Networkers 2009

Je passe la semaine à Barcelone pour la conférence Cisco Networkers 2009.

Cisco Networkers 2009 in Barcelona, Spain

Cisco Networkers 2009 in Barcelona, Spain

Pour les curieux, voici la liste des interventions des que je vais suivre :

  • IPv6
  • Emerging Threats
  • Integrated Security for Wireless LAN and Guest Access
  • Cloud Computing – How Will it Affect Your Data Center ?
  • 6 Steps to Improve Your Security Monitoring
  • Inside Unified Communications
  • VoIP deployment in SMB
  • Deploying Presence with Cisco Unified Communication Solutions
  • Deploying Cisco Network Admission Control
  • Advanced Voice over Wireless
  • Cisco Unified Communication Manager Express

Les sessions sont vraiment intéressantes (pour celles que j’ai déjà pu faire hier et aujourd’hui), on a accès à tout un panel de technologies, et de personnes qui sont des références dans leurs domaines.

Sinon, euuuhhh… il fait beau à Barcelone (on peut regretter un peu de vent résiduel), mon hôtel est vraiment chouette, et le WiFi marche du tonnerre (bon, c’est Cisco quand même quoi). :)